Einblicke

Schnellstartanleitung für eingebettetes Reporting

Embedded reports and data visualization provide analytic tools to help product managers make informed decisions

Die Datenanalyse erfreut sich zunehmender Beliebtheit, da Unternehmen nach neuen Möglichkeiten suchen, Strategien zu entwickeln und fundiertere Entscheidungen zu treffen. Produktmanager können diese Nachfrage befriedigen, indem sie Tools für das Reporting, Datenvisualisierung und -analyse in ihre Software integrieren, um das Kundenerlebnis zu verbessern und einen Wettbewerbsvorteil zu erzielen. Es ist jedoch nicht immer einfach, die richtige Lösung für das Reporting zu finden. 

Dieser Leitfaden beschreibt die wichtigsten Faktoren, die bei der Auswahl einer Lösung für eingebettetes Reporting zu berücksichtigen sind. Wir heben außerdem die Funktionen von Jaspersoft als die flexibelste und anpassbarste Business-Intelligence-Reporting-Plattform hervor. 

Erste Schritte mit eingebettetem Reporting 

Wie der Name schon sagt, werden beim eingebetteten Reporting leistungsstarke Business Intelligence (BI)-Tools in Softwareanwendungen integriert. Diese Lösungen ermöglichen es Endbenutzern, Daten zu analysieren und Berichte zu erstellen, ohne zu einer separaten Plattform oder Anwendung wechseln zu müssen. 

Produktmanager und Softwareentwickler integrieren Reporting häufig, um eine nahtlose Benutzererfahrung zu schaffen. Es gibt kein Patentrezept für die Integration dieser Funktionen in die Software, so dass mehrere Optionen in Betracht gezogen werden müssen. 

Entscheiden Sie zwischen Eigenentwicklung oder Kauf

Es gibt zwei Möglichkeiten, Software mit eingebettetem Reporting auszustatten: die Entwicklung eines eigenen Tools von Grund auf oder der Kauf einer vorgefertigten Plattform. 

Der Weg der Eigenentwicklung

Die Erstellung eingebetteter Reporting-Tools bietet mehrere Vorteile. Dieser Ansatz bietet die vollständige Kontrolle über das Design und die Funktionalität des Tools, da die Entwicklungsteams ein maßgeschneidertes Tool erstellen können, das den spezifischen Anforderungen und Geschäftsbedürfnissen entspricht. 

Dieser Prozess kann Folgendes beinhalten: 

  • Definition der Projektanforderungen

  • Gestaltung der Benutzeroberflächen und Layouts des Tools

  • Kodierung der erforderlichen Reporting-Funktionen 

  • Testen und Verfeinern der eingebetteten Reporting-Funktionalität

  • Einsatz des Tools in der Anwendung 

  • Wartung und Aktualisierung des Reporting-Tools

Dieser Ansatz ist in der Regel mit unvorhersehbaren Kosten verbunden und erfordert eine höhere Anfangsinvestition als der Kauf eines vorgefertigten Tools. Unternehmen müssen laufende Wartungs- und Entwicklungskosten sowie eine verzögerte Markteinführung einkalkulieren. Der Produktentwickler muss jedoch keine Lizenzgebühren oder Abonnementkosten zahlen. 

Außerdem fehlt es den selbst entwickelten Tools oft an fortgeschrittenen Funktionen. Die Eigenentwicklung kann Unternehmen dazu zwingen, ihre Aufmerksamkeit und den Support von anderen wichtigen IT-Projekten abzuziehen, wie z. B. der Verfeinerung der Benutzeroberfläche oder der Verbesserung der Benutzerfreundlichkeit, was zu verpassten Chancen und höheren Kosten führt. 

Der Weg des Käufers 

Der Kauf einer eingebetteten Reporting-Lösung kann ein viel einfacheres und schnelleres Verfahren sein, während sich die Produktmanager auf ihr Kerngeschäft konzentrieren können. Die Käufer müssen einfach: 

  • Verfügbare Reporting-Tools recherchieren

  • Eine benutzerfreundliche Lösung wählen, welche zu den Projektanforderungen passt

  • Das Tool in die Anwendung integrieren

  • An Schulungen des Anbieters teilnehmen, um zu lernen, wie man die Funktionen des Produkts effektiv nutzt und die Endbenutzer unterstützt

Die Wahl eines vorgefertigten Tools für das Reporting und eingebettete Analysen kann die Zeit für die Anwendungsentwicklung und -integration erheblich reduzieren. Zeit ist Geld auf dem umkämpften Softwaremarkt. Die Zeit, die Produktmanager bei der Markteinführung einer etablierten Lösung sparen, kann ihrem Unternehmen einen erheblichen Vorteil verschaffen. 

Viele Anbieter bieten auch einen kontinuierlichen Kundensupport an. Diese Unterstützung kann Einzelberatungen mit dem technischen Team des Anbieters, Community-Foren, Schulungs-Webinare und weitere hilfreiche Ressourcen umfassen. Diese verschiedenen Kundensupport-Lösungen können Entwicklern helfen, ihre Produktivität zu steigern, Probleme schnell zu diagnostizieren und zu lösen und Ausfallzeiten zu reduzieren. 

Ein vorgefertigtes eingebettetes Reporting-Tool kann jedoch mehr Einschränkungen aufweisen als eine maßgeschneiderte Lösung. So müssen die Benutzer beispielsweise darauf warten, dass der Anbieter Aktualisierungen vornimmt, und das Produkt verfügt möglicherweise über weniger Anpassungsmöglichkeiten, um spezifische Anforderungen zu erfüllen. 

Vergleich der Kaufoptionen 

Produktmanager, die ein eingebettetes Reporting-Tool erwerben, müssen zwischen zwei Arten von Lösungen wählen: Open Source oder kommerziell. 

Open Source

Es gibt viele kostenlose Open-Source-BI-Reporting-Tools, darunter Apache Superset, Jaspersoft und Metabase. Benutzer können auf den Quellcode zugreifen, um die Tools weiter anzupassen und individueller zu gestalten.

Open-Source-Tools werden von Communities aus Softwareentwicklern und anderen Produktnutzern entwickelt und gepflegt, die häufig kostenlose Beratung und Ressourcen bereitstellen. Allerdings bekommt man, wofür man bezahlt. Für diese Tools gibt es oft keinen speziellen professionellen Support, und die Benutzer können bei der Integration in bestehende Anwendungen auf erhebliche Probleme stoßen oder bei komplizierten Problemen lange Lösungszeiten in Kauf nehmen. 

Kommerziell 

Viele Anbieter haben kommerzielle eingebettete Reporting-Tools entwickelt. Kommerzielle Lösungen verfügen in der Regel über komfortablere und erweiterte Funktionen als Open-Source-Tools. Anbieter stellen in der Regel regelmäßige Updates und dedizierten Support bereit.  

Natürlich sind diese Vorteile mit Kosten verbunden. Die meisten kommerziellen Produkte haben monatliche oder jährliche Abonnementgebühren. Darüber hinaus stellen kommerzielle Lösungen in der Regel keinen Quellcode zur Verfügung, was die Möglichkeiten eines Entwicklers einschränkt, eigene Funktionen zu entwickeln. 

Bewerten Sie die Anforderungen Ihres Anwendungsfalls 

Beim Vergleich der Optionen sollten Sie die Anforderungen Ihres Anwendungsfalls im Auge behalten. Zu den wichtigen Faktoren, die zu berücksichtigen sind, gehören:  

  • APIs: Bewerten Sie, wie tief und nahtlos Sie das Reporting-Tool in Ihre Anwendung integrieren können. Die leistungsfähigsten Tools ermöglichen es Ihnen außerdem, Analysen und Visualisierungen in Ihrem eigenen Branding und Stil einzubetten, während Sie gleichzeitig die Kontrolle über Funktionen wie Symbolleisten und Navigation erhalten. 

  • Flexibilität: Ein architekturunabhängiges Reporting-Tool bietet Flexibilität für die Integration in verschiedene Umgebungen und Systeme. Das Tool muss sich auch an die Anforderungen verschiedener Plattformen anpassen und mit vielen verschiedenen Datenquellen verbunden werden können. 

  • Sicherheitsintegration und -unterstützung: Reporting-Tools sollten über fortschrittliche Sicherheitsfunktionen verfügen, um Daten zu schützen und zu verhindern, dass unbefugte Benutzer auf vertrauliche Informationen zugreifen können. Die sichersten Tools ermöglichen es Administratoren, Benutzerkonten zu authentifizieren, Passwörter zu verschlüsseln, Zugriffsberechtigungen zu definieren und die Sicherheit auf Datenebene durchzusetzen. 

  • Anpassung: Anpassbare Reporting-Tools ermöglichen es Entwicklern, die Benutzeroberfläche, Berichtskonfigurationen und andere Elemente mit pixelgenauer Präzision zu gestalten. 

  • Preisgestaltung: Wählen Sie einen Anbieter mit transparenten Preisen und Dienstleistungen, die Ihrem Budget und Ihren Reporting-Anforderungen entsprechen. Einige Anbieter bieten OEM-Lizenzen (Original Equipment Manufacturer) an, mit denen Kunden ihre Produkte als Teil ihrer Software weiterverkaufen können. 

  • Skalierbarkeit: Eingebettete Reporting-Tools, die in Cloud-Umgebungen eingesetzt werden können, ermöglichen eine schnelle und kostengünstige Skalierung der Rechenressourcen, um Flexibilität zu gewährleisten und mehr Daten oder Benutzeraktivitäten zu unterstützen. 

Finden Sie Partner, die Ihre Anforderungen erfüllen – und übertreffen 

Viele Produktmanager bevorzugen den hochflexiblen API-zentrierten Ansatz von Jaspersoft, der es ihnen ermöglicht, Reporting in jede Umgebung zu integrieren. Jaspersoft ist Open Source und kann genau an Ihre sich entwickelnden Anforderungen angepasst werden. Darüber hinaus bietet ihre Lösung erweiterte Multi-Tenant-Unterstützung und die Integration von Identitätsmanagement. 

Zusätzlich bietet die kommerzielle Edition von Jaspersoft dedizierten professionellen Support sowie eine lebendige, globale Community, in der Nutzer hilfreiche Anleitungen finden, auf Codebeispiele zugreifen und bewährte Methoden entdecken können. 

Diese erfolgreiche Kombination ermöglicht es Ihnen, das Tool an Ihre Anforderungen anzupassen, ohne auf das Sicherheitsnetz der zuverlässigen Unterstützung durch den Hersteller verzichten zu müssen. Sie können beruhigt experimentieren, denn Jaspersoft konzentriert sich zu 100 % darauf, Ihnen bei der Gestaltung, Einbettung, Verwaltung und Bereitstellung von hochvolumigen, pixelgenauen Berichten, Self-Service-Ad-hoc-Berichten und Dashboards zu helfen – mit Entwicklerkontrolle auf der flexibelsten und anpassbarsten BI-Plattform, die verfügbar ist. 

Treffen Sie die beste Entscheidung für eingebettetes Reporting 

Auch wenn es viele Faktoren bei der Auswahl einer eingebetteten Reporting-Lösung zu berücksichtigen gibt, bietet für die meisten kommerziellen Anwendungen die Zusammenarbeit mit dem richtigen Softwareanbieter die vorteilhafteste, effizienteste und insgesamt kostengünstigste Lösung. Vorgefertigte Reporting- und eingebettete Analyseplattformen wie Jaspersoft verfügen über robuste Funktionen und umfassenden Support und bieten Entwicklern dennoch Flexibilität und Skalierbarkeit. 

Sind Sie bereit, mit Jaspersoft Reports zu starten? Starten Sie eine kostenlose 30-Tage-Testversion oder kontaktieren Sie uns, um mehr über unsere Produkte, Funktionen und Preise zu erfahren.

Testen Sie Jaspersoft 30 Tage lang kostenlos

Effizientes Entwerfen, Einbetten und Verteilen von Berichten und Dashboards in großem Umfang mit Jaspersoft.

Ähnliche Ressourcen

NEU!

Monatliche Live-Demos mit Fragen und Antworten

Jeden 3. Mittwoch in 3 Regionen von unseren Lösungsingenieuren veranstaltet.

Jetzt registrieren

Dr. Jaspersoft: Embed Your Analytics with Visualize.js

Discover the power of embedded analytics and how you can seamlessly integrate it into your platform using the Visualize.js framework, transforming your data into actionable insights with ease!

 On-demand webinar (42:17)

Jaspersoft community vs. commercial edition - which edition is right for you?

Jaspersoft reporting software is available in two editions — commercial and community— and in this webinar, our experts will walk you through the considerations when choosing a reporting platform, core features of each edition, and comparison of functionality and key benefits to help you determine which is right for you based on your current needs and future plans for growth.

 On-demand webinar (30:54)

Dr. Jaspersoft: Unlocking the Power of Jaspersoft Dashboards

For a comprehensive understanding of Jaspersoft's rich feature set and functionalities to maximize your dashboard's potential, this webinar dives into the intricacies of data visualization, customization options, near real-time analytics, and much more to help you make data-driven decisions, streamline your workflow, and enhance your project's performance.

 On-demand webinar (49:40)

Sind Sie bereit, es auszuprobieren?

Starten Sie jetzt Ihre 30-tägige Testversion.